Game Story
The Manitoba Moose (17-20-3-2) entered the final games of their road swing with a matchup against the Charlotte Checkers (19-21-3-0) on Friday night.  It only took 20 seconds for Charlotte to break the ice when Jake Chelios set up Andrej Nestrasil for a backdoor goal on a two-on-one.  That would be the only puck to get past Eric Comrie who made nine stops in the period.  After being outshot 8-1 early, Manitoba closed the gap to 10-8 Checkers on the shot clock after one.

It took until after the midway point of the second to see another goal on the board.  Mitchell Heard got the puck on net off the rush and Kris Newbury was on the scene to roof his sixth of the season for a 2-0 Charlotte lead.  The Moose had a pair of powerplay opportunities in the frame, but couldn’t take advantage.  Eddie Lack was sharp through 40 minutes, having turned aside all 17 shots he faced to keep the Checkers ahead by a pair.

Charlotte made it 3-0 just 1:09 into the final stanza as Lucas Wallmark got a little room in the slot and fired a shot by Comrie.  JC Lipon got the Moose on the board coming up on the six minute mark of the period.  The Manitoba forward launched a shot off the glove of Lack which popped into the air.  Lipon swooped around the net to grab the rebound and backhand it into the goal.  The Moose pushed late, but couldn’t cut into the Charlotte lead.  Wallmark added his second of the period into an empty net for the 4-1 final score

Quick Hits

  • Eric Comrie made his fifth straight start, making 23 saves in the loss.
  • JC Lipon has four (2G, 2A) of his 13 points in five games against Charlotte.
